About Alessandro Frigiola

Alessandro Frigiola is a scholar working on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Epidemiology, Surgery and Critical Care and Intensive Care Medicine, having authored 187 papers that have together received 6.1k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Congenital Heart Disease Studies (64 papers), Cardiac Valve Diseases and Treatments (49 papers), Cardiac Structural Anomalies and Repair (36 papers), Aortic Disease and Treatment Approaches (28 papers), Cardiac, Anesthesia and Surgical Outcomes (21 papers), Mechanical Circulatory Support Devices (18 papers), Cardiovascular and Diving-Related Complications (16 papers) and Coronary Artery Anomalies (16 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ine (3.0k citations),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ine (2.7k citations), Critical Care and Intensive Care Medicine (394 citations), Biochemistry (435 citations) and Epidemiology (2.0k citations). Alessandro Frigiola has collaborated with scholars based in Italy, United States and Egypt. Frequent co-authors include Lorenzo Menicanti, Marco Ranucci, Alessandro Giamberti, Serenella Castelvecchio, Gianfranco Butera, Mário Carminati, Massimo Chessa, Raúl Abella, Eduardo Bossone and Gabriele Pelissero. Their work appears in journals such as The Annals of Thoracic Surgery, Journal of Thoracic and Cardiovascular Surgery, European Journal of Cardio-Thoracic Surgery, The Journal of Maternal-Fetal & Neonatal Medicine and European Heart Journal.
